Page 1 sur 3

Envoi automatique de mails

Posté : lun. 26 mars 2018 11:05
par gkientzel
Bonjour,

Voici mon problème, j'ai configuré mon SMTP sur Gestsup et lorsque je créer un ticket, le bouton envoyer un mail me permet effectivement d'envoyer un mail à l'utilisateur et à l'administrateur en copie, mais lorsque je clique seulement sur envoyer, aucun mail n'arrive.

J'ai bien coché les cases nécessaires.

Image

Espérant que vous pourrez m'aider.

Cordialement.

Re: Envoi automatique de mails

Posté : lun. 26 mars 2018 12:36
par Flox
Bonjour,

Pouvez vous activer le mode debug et regarder si des messages apparaissent.

Cdt

Re: Envoi automatique de mails

Posté : lun. 26 mars 2018 13:36
par gkientzel
J'ai bien le debug mode activé, rien d'anormal n'apparait à l'ouverture d'un ticket, ni de messages d'erreur, et toujours rien sur la boite mail administrateur (et utilisateur) en utilisant le bouton Envoyer ->.

Cordialement

Re: Envoi automatique de mails

Posté : lun. 26 mars 2018 17:02
par Flox
Indiquez votre version

Re: Envoi automatique de mails

Posté : mar. 27 mars 2018 10:10
par gkientzel
Actuellement, sur la version 3.1.31.

Cordialement

Re: Envoi automatique de mails

Posté : mar. 27 mars 2018 10:15
par Flox
Pouvez vous essayer d'envoyer un mail manuellement pour voir si votre connecteur est opérationel

Re: Envoi automatique de mails

Posté : mar. 27 mars 2018 10:22
par gkientzel
En effet justement, en utilisant le bouton envoyer un mail, il l'envoit bien à l'utilisateur ainsi qu'a l'administrateur en copie, mais le mail automatique ne donne toujours rien pour le moment.

Re: Envoi automatique de mails

Posté : mar. 27 mars 2018 10:28
par Flox
Bonjour,

pouvez vous nous transmettre le log d'erreur Apache afin d'analyser le dysfonctionnement.

Cdt

Re: Envoi automatique de mails

Posté : mar. 27 mars 2018 10:57
par gkientzel
Eh bien, désolé d'avance, nouveau jour nouvelle erreur, même par le bouton envoyer un mail, ce dernier cette fois m'affiche une erreur via le debug mode ( je n'ai pourtant pas touché au serveur depuis hier où cela marchait ).

Je vous copie l'erreur et les logs d'erreurs d'apache.
Fatal error: Uncaught PHPMailer\PHPMailer\Exception: Could not instantiate mail function. in /var/www/html/components/PHPMailer/src/PHPMailer.php:1671 Stack trace: #0 /var/www/html/components/PHPMailer/src/PHPMailer.php(1483): PHPMailer\PHPMailer\PHPMailer->mailSend('Date: Tue, 27 M...', '\n\t<html>\n\t\t<hea...') #1 /var/www/html/components/PHPMailer/src/PHPMailer.php(1320): PHPMailer\PHPMailer\PHPMailer->postSend() #2 /var/www/html/core/mail.php(482): PHPMailer\PHPMailer\PHPMailer->send() #3 /var/www/html/preview_mail.php(27): require('/var/www/html/c...') #4 /var/www/html/index.php(887): include('/var/www/html/p...') #5 {main} thrown in /var/www/html/components/PHPMailer/src/PHPMailer.php on line 1671
Voici le log d'hier, celui d’aujourd’hui n'est que l'erreur d'au dessus une paire de fois.
[Mon Mar 26 00:09:36.916908 2018] [mpm_prefork:notice] [pid 867] AH00163: Apache/2.4.27 (Ubuntu) configured -- resuming normal operations
[Mon Mar 26 00:09:36.916935 2018] [core:notice] [pid 867] AH00094: Command line: '/usr/sbin/apache2'
[Mon Mar 26 10:00:07.891789 2018] [php7:error] [pid 385] [client 192.168.1.74:62068] PHP Fatal error: Uncaught PHPMailer\\PHPMailer\\Exception: SMTP connect() failed. https://github.com/PHPMailer/PHPMailer/ ... leshooting in /var/www/html/components/PHPMailer/src/PHPMailer.php:1726\nStack trace:\n#0 /var/www/html/components/PHPMailer/src/PHPMailer.php(1481): PHPMailer\\PHPMailer\\PHPMailer->smtpSend('Date: Mon, 26 M...', '\\r\\n\\t<html>\\r\\n\\t\\t<h...')\n#1 /var/www/html/components/PHPMailer/src/PHPMailer.php(1320): PHPMailer\\PHPMailer\\PHPMailer->postSend()\n#2 /var/www/html/core/mail.php(482): PHPMailer\\PHPMailer\\PHPMailer->send()\n#3 /var/www/html/preview_mail.php(27): require('/var/www/html/c...')\n#4 /var/www/html/index.php(887): include('/var/www/html/p...')\n#5 {main}\n thrown in /var/www/html/components/PHPMailer/src/PHPMailer.php on line 1726, referer: http://192.168.1.200/index.php?page=pre ... &date_end=
[Mon Mar 26 10:06:03.561488 2018] [php7:error] [pid 3524] [client 192.168.1.74:62079] PHP Fatal error: Uncaught PHPMailer\\PHPMailer\\Exception: SMTP Error: Could not authenticate. in /var/www/html/components/PHPMailer/src/PHPMailer.php:1911\nStack trace:\n#0 /var/www/html/components/PHPMailer/src/PHPMailer.php(1725): PHPMailer\\PHPMailer\\PHPMailer->smtpConnect(Array)\n#1 /var/www/html/components/PHPMailer/src/PHPMailer.php(1481): PHPMailer\\PHPMailer\\PHPMailer->smtpSend('Date: Mon, 26 M...', '\\r\\n\\t<html>\\r\\n\\t\\t<h...')\n#2 /var/www/html/components/PHPMailer/src/PHPMailer.php(1320): PHPMailer\\PHPMailer\\PHPMailer->postSend()\n#3 /var/www/html/core/mail.php(482): PHPMailer\\PHPMailer\\PHPMailer->send()\n#4 /var/www/html/preview_mail.php(27): require('/var/www/html/c...')\n#5 /var/www/html/index.php(887): include('/var/www/html/p...')\n#6 {main}\n thrown in /var/www/html/components/PHPMailer/src/PHPMailer.php on line 1911, referer: http://192.168.1.200/index.php?page=pre ... &date_end=
[Mon Mar 26 10:09:13.817145 2018] [php7:error] [pid 385] [client 192.168.1.74:62372] PHP Fatal error: Uncaught PDOException: SQLSTATE[42S22]: Column not found: 1054 Unknown column 'tservices.id' in 'field list' in /var/www/html/admin/list.php:1062\nStack trace:\n#0 /var/www/html/admin/list.php(1062): PDOStatement->execute(Array)\n#1 /var/www/html/admin.php(24): include('/var/www/html/a...')\n#2 /var/www/html/index.php(887): include('/var/www/html/a...')\n#3 {main}\n thrown in /var/www/html/admin/list.php on line 1062, referer: http://192.168.1.200/index.php?page=admin&subpage=list
sh: 1: /var/qmail/bin/qmail-inject: not found
[Mon Mar 26 10:26:55.329239 2018] [php7:error] [pid 3288] [client 192.168.1.74:62518] PHP Fatal error: Uncaught PHPMailer\\PHPMailer\\Exception: Could not execute: /var/qmail/bin/qmail-inject in /var/www/html/components/PHPMailer/src/PHPMailer.php:1577\nStack trace:\n#0 /var/www/html/components/PHPMailer/src/PHPMailer.php(1479): PHPMailer\\PHPMailer\\PHPMailer->sendmailSend('Date: Mon, 26 M...', '\\n\\t<html>\\n\\t\\t<hea...')\n#1 /var/www/html/components/PHPMailer/src/PHPMailer.php(1320): PHPMailer\\PHPMailer\\PHPMailer->postSend()\n#2 /var/www/html/core/mail.php(482): PHPMailer\\PHPMailer\\PHPMailer->send()\n#3 /var/www/html/preview_mail.php(27): require('/var/www/html/c...')\n#4 /var/www/html/index.php(887): include('/var/www/html/p...')\n#5 {main}\n thrown in /var/www/html/components/PHPMailer/src/PHPMailer.php on line 1577, referer: http://192.168.1.200/index.php?page=pre ... &date_end=
sh: 1: /usr/sbin/sendmail: not found
[Mon Mar 26 11:07:50.000552 2018] [php7:error] [pid 3561] [client 192.168.1.74:60053] PHP Fatal error: Uncaught PHPMailer\\PHPMailer\\Exception: Could not instantiate mail function. in /var/www/html/components/PHPMailer/src/PHPMailer.php:1671\nStack trace:\n#0 /var/www/html/components/PHPMailer/src/PHPMailer.php(1483): PHPMailer\\PHPMailer\\PHPMailer->mailSend('Date: Mon, 26 M...', '\\n\\t<html>\\n\\t\\t<hea...')\n#1 /var/www/html/components/PHPMailer/src/PHPMailer.php(1320): PHPMailer\\PHPMailer\\PHPMailer->postSend()\n#2 /var/www/html/core/mail.php(482): PHPMailer\\PHPMailer\\PHPMailer->send()\n#3 /var/www/html/preview_mail.php(27): require('/var/www/html/c...')\n#4 /var/www/html/index.php(887): include('/var/www/html/p...')\n#5 {main}\n thrown in /var/www/html/components/PHPMailer/src/PHPMailer.php on line 1671, referer: http://192.168.1.200/index.php?page=pre ... &date_end=
[Mon Mar 26 11:09:34.529922 2018] [php7:notice] [pid 384] [client 192.168.1.74:60125] PHP Notice: Undefined variable: company_filter in /var/www/html/asset_stat.php on line 47, referer: http://192.168.1.200/index.php?page=admin&subpage=list
[Mon Mar 26 12:28:12.292544 2018] [php7:error] [pid 384] [client 192.168.1.74:50943] PHP Fatal error: Uncaught PDOException: SQLSTATE[42S22]: Column not found: 1054 Unknown column 'service' in 'where clause' in /var/www/html/admin/list.php:1502\nStack trace:\n#0 /var/www/html/admin/list.php(1502): PDO->query('SELECT * FROM `...')\n#1 /var/www/html/admin.php(24): include('/var/www/html/a...')\n#2 /var/www/html/index.php(887): include('/var/www/html/a...')\n#3 {main}\n thrown in /var/www/html/admin/list.php on line 1502, referer: http://192.168.1.200/index.php?page=adm ... le=tsubcat
[Mon Mar 26 12:28:37.128151 2018] [php7:error] [pid 3288] [client 192.168.1.74:50945] PHP Fatal error: Uncaught PDOException: SQLSTATE[42S22]: Column not found: 1054 Unknown column 'service' in 'where clause' in /var/www/html/admin/list.php:1502\nStack trace:\n#0 /var/www/html/admin/list.php(1502): PDO->query('SELECT * FROM `...')\n#1 /var/www/html/admin.php(24): include('/var/www/html/a...')\n#2 /var/www/html/index.php(887): include('/var/www/html/a...')\n#3 {main}\n thrown in /var/www/html/admin/list.php on line 1502, referer: http://192.168.1.200/index.php?page=adm ... le=tsubcat
[Mon Mar 26 12:28:48.400415 2018] [php7:error] [pid 385] [client 192.168.1.74:50946] PHP Fatal error: Uncaught PDOException: SQLSTATE[42S22]: Column not found: 1054 Unknown column 'service' in 'where clause' in /var/www/html/admin/list.php:1502\nStack trace:\n#0 /var/www/html/admin/list.php(1502): PDO->query('SELECT * FROM `...')\n#1 /var/www/html/admin.php(24): include('/var/www/html/a...')\n#2 /var/www/html/index.php(887): include('/var/www/html/a...')\n#3 {main}\n thrown in /var/www/html/admin/list.php on line 1502, referer: http://192.168.1.200/index.php?page=adm ... le=tsubcat
[Tue Mar 27 00:05:36.932192 2018] [mpm_prefork:notice] [pid 867] AH00171: Graceful restart requested, doing restart
AH00558: apache2: Could not reliably determine the server's fully qualified domain name, using 127.0.1.1. Set the 'ServerName' directive globally to suppress this message

Re: Envoi automatique de mails

Posté : lun. 20 août 2018 14:01
par samy
Bonjour,

Je me permets de remonter ce post car je rencontre le même problème.
L'envoi automatique d'email après la mise à jour d'un ticket ne fonctionne pas, cependant, lorsqu'on clique sur "Envoyer un email", l'envoi fonctionne.

Pouvez-vous m'indiquer comment dépanner svp?
Merci.